3D Human Pose Estimation: The Deep Learning Revolution
Monday, March 10, 2025
Researchers have been testing different models and datasets to see what works best. They've found that while deep learning has come a long way, there's still room for improvement. The key is finding models that are both precise and efficient.
One of the big questions is how to handle data constraints. Deep learning models need lots of data to train, but getting that data can be hard. Researchers are looking for ways to make the most of the data they have.
The future of 3D HPE looks promising. As deep learning models get better, we can expect to see even more amazing applications. But it's not just about the tech. We also need to think about the ethical implications and potential misuse of this technology.
